    Talking SimpleRoot (super simple root for your Acer Iconia Tab A200)

    Hello All,

    Some of you might know that we have been working away on getting a true root access to our A200 tabs.
    So now the wait for the masses is over! Follow these simple instructions and you will be king of your tab in no time!

    --EDIT!-- 03/12/2012 version 3 is up! now includes superuser.apk install! works on all current releases of ICS!

    I tested this with the OFFICIAL UNITED STATES ICS RELEASE. although I have not tested this with the leaked version I have been told that it works. Also because of how this works I'm fairly confident that this would work with other countries versions of ICS, however i only have my tab so again untested...

    1. on your A200 open the settings and go to the Developer Options. Enable USB debugging.

    2. Download this and then extract the folder. update see below!

    3. Download the drivers for your Tab from Acer @ http://global-download.acer.com/GDFi...C=Acer&SC=PA_6 .Open the zip file you downloaded and run the setup.exe and follow the directions.Once all drivers have installed you are ready to move on to next step.

    4. Connect your A200 to your Windows based PC.

    5. Open the Acer A200 SimpleRoot folder and double click on the simple.bat (Make sure that your Tab is awake after plugging it in.)

    6. Once you do this on your A200 will reboot and then you will see two icons on the screen. You use the volume rocker to make your choice and confirm. First you will use the left or volume down to select your choice and then you will use the right or volume up to confirm. You want to select the unlocked lock and then confirm. If you wait more than a couple of seconds the A200 will time out and then you will need to start over by closing the simple.bat window and then powering down and back up. After that you would start the simple.bat over

    7. after selecting the unlocked lock and confirming with the volume up key return back to the simple.bat and press any key to continue.

    8. Enjoy knowing the man can't hold you down!

    NEW Update! Sunday March 18th 2012
    completely redesigned the tools- I have combined the SimpleRecovery and SimpleRoot into one new tool- Acer A200 SimpleTool
    Acer A200 SimpleTool is a windows comand line tool that will allow you to install my custom kernel that allows the /system partition be to mounted with read/write permissions, it will also allow you to install the ClockWorkMod Custom Recovery, and finally it will allow you to gain root access to your Tab and install superuser.

    Instructions

    Download the folder from here - http://db.tt/xYiNjrv5
    unzip the folder to your desktop
    open the folder and double click the AcerA200SimpleTool.bat
    a command window will open up and you just need to follow the directions!


    Attachment 711Attachment 712Attachment 713









    *you have to have a external sd card to back up, flash, and ant other thing that requires storage.*


    As always you do this at your own risk please heed the warnings and follow the directions!
